Population and Public Health Services: School Health Program

Population and Public Health Services provide health services in schools in the Regina Qu'Appelle Health Region. Professional staff from Public Health work with school staff and promote school based, health promotion activities which encourage students to adopt a healthy lifestyle and take responsibility for their own health.

Individual student counselling is available by referral from teachers, students and parents.

Specific services that may be offered in the school are:
  • immunizations
  • hearing screening by referral
  • dental health information
  • nutrition information
  • information on specific health issues
  • health promotion strategies
